About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

About
Greyhound Lines, Inc. is a prominent American intercity bus transportation provider, established in 1914. It operates the largest intercity bus network in the United States, also extending services to Canada and Mexico. Greyhound is known for offering affordable and reliable long-distance travel, connecting major cities and rural communities across North America. The company's buses are equipped with amenities such as free Wi-Fi, power outlets, and extra legroom to enhance passenger comfort. Greyhound is a subsidiary of Flix SE, which also owns FlixBus, and together they offer an extensive network of over 1,600 destinations.

Complete guide to Sarasota

Things to do in Sarasota

Discover the best of Sarasota —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ect Sarasota trip today.

  • Must visit

The John and Mable Ringling Museum of Art

State art museum on the former Ringling estate, known for its European paintings, circus history, and bayfront grounds. One of Sarasota’s signature cultural attractions.

  • Must visit

Ca' d'Zan

The Ringlings’ Venetian Gothic mansion offers a museum-like look into the family’s lifestyle, interiors, and Sarasota’s Gilded Age legacy.

  • Recommended

Sarasota Art Museum

Contemporary art museum in the restored Sarasota High School building, featuring rotating exhibitions and strong architecture as part of the experience.

United States Dollar

Prices are moderate by U.S. beach-city standards. Casual dining is affordable, while hotels and waterfront dining can cost more in peak season.

Average meal costs

Budget
USD 10-18 for fast food or a simple lunch.
Mid-range
USD 20-40 per person at a casual sit-down restaurant.
Fine dining
USD 60-120+ per person at upscale restaurants.
Coffee
USD 3-6 for drip coffee or a latte.

Tipping culture

Tip 18-20% at restaurants; 20% for great service. Tip bartenders USD 1-2 per drink, taxis and rideshares 10-15%, hotel staff USD 2-5, and round up for cafés if desired.

How long is the journey by bus from Miami to Sarasota?

The distance between Miami and Sarasota is about 180 miles (290 km). On most days, only direct buses ply this route, and a single connecting bus from Greyhound offers its services on Saturdays and Sundays. FlixBus and Greyhound are the two bus companies with buses plying this route. The fastest FlixBus bus from Miami to Sarasota covers the 180 miles (290 km) in about 3h 50min. A direct Greyhound trip to Sarasota takes about 7h 25min and 13h 54min with a single changeover in Orlando. What is/are the departure and arrival stations for buses from Miami to Sarasota?

Departure bus station: Miami Airport Intermodal Station is about 6 miles (9.6 km) from downtown Miami, and the bus or ORANGE Line train should get you downtown easily. Facilities at the station include ticket offices, daytime parking, and elevators. The station is wheelchair accessible.

Arrival bus station: Cattlemen Transfer Station is about 6 miles (9.6 km) from downtown Sarasota, and the bus or taxis are the quickest way of getting downtown. The station is wheelchair accessible, and facilities include ticket offices, waiting room, parking lot, and clean restrooms.

Greyhound buses from Miami to Sarasota

Greyhound is one of the major long-distance bus companies in the US. They have a bus from Miami to Sarasota at least six days a week. They have both direct and connecting buses, with the connecting buses available only during the weekend. Their buses are mostly night buses, with most departures from Miami happening at around 1:55 a.m. for the direct bus and 12:01 a.m. for the connecting service. The direct bus from Miami to Sarasota takes about 7h 25min, and the connecting one takes about 13h 54min, with a 4h 40min changeover in Orlando.

FlixBus buses from Miami to Sarasota

FlixBus is one of the newer long-distance bus companies that has steadily rose in the industry to become a leader in the sector. They have at least three daily departures from Miami to Sarasota. The departures can be up to four on a good day, with a morning, mid-morning, noon, and afternoon bus to Sarasota. FlixBus only has direct buses, and the first departure is at around 8:35 a.m., and the last departure is at around 2:30 p.m. They offer the fastest bus trip from Miami to Sarasota, taking about 3h 50min. You can also choose the slower FlixBus journeys taking around 4h 15min for cheaper fares.

How to find cheap bus tickets from Miami to Sarasota

There are three ways you can save money as you book your bus ticket from Miami to Sarasota. First, book in advance. Booking your ticket weeks in advance allows you to get cheaper fares than booking on the day of traveling. Second, choose the slower or connecting journeys as these are much cheaper than the direct or faster journeys. Finally, be flexible with your travel dates. Some buses are cheaper on other days than others, and being flexible allows you to book your ticket when the fares are lowest.

To Sarasota by bus – travel tips

Sarasota is an ideal town for a vacation. If you haven’t been to Sarasota, you probably don’t know about the beautiful beaches, pristine golf courses, lush green gardens, historical landmarks, and cultural activities that make this town a paradise in Florida.

Sarasota has fantastic weather most of the year, meaning you’ll have more time to spend outdoors. Siesta Key Beach is one of the Sarasota beaches, and it has been rated as one of the most beautiful beaches in the world. So if you enjoy watersports, sunbathing, or building castles in the sand with your kids, Sarasota is the place to visit.

Another perk of visiting this town is the food. Since it’s in the Gulf of Mexico, you’ll eat a lot of fresh, affordable seafood. This town has many great dining options, from casual sports bars and pubs to upscale bistros by the ocean. Couples too will love this town since it has many hidden gems ready to pamper you and your loved one.

Moreover, there are many pretty parks in Sarasota where you can sweep your partner off their feet with a great picnic or a night under the Floridian stars.
